- Summary:
- Fatima lives on her own with two daughters to support: 15-year old Souad, a teenager in revolt, and 18-year old Nesrine, who is starting medical school. Inspired by a true story and the poetry of the North African writer Fatima Elayoubi, who immigrated knowing very little French and slowly taught herself the language. A patient, reflective study of a woman pressured by her children and her neighbors alike to assimilate into a culture of which she's wary. Official Selection at the **Cannes Film Festival.** Winner of the Best Film, Most Promising Actress and Best Adaptation Award at the **César Awards.** *"Honest, direct and dramatic without any sense of special pleading or situations pushed too far." - Kenneth Turan, **Los Angeles Times*** *"A small miracle of a film from the French director Philippe Faucon." - Stephen Holden, **The New York Times***
